Kindergarten Sight Word Worksheets
Sight word worksheets are a valuable tool for helping kindergarten students learn to recognize and read common words. These worksheets can be used in a variety of ways, such as for independent practice, homework, or assessment. There are many different types of sight word worksheets available, so it is important to choose ones that are appropriate for the needs of your students.
Here are some examples of sight word worksheets that you can use in your kindergarten classroom:
- Matching worksheets: These worksheets require students to match sight words to pictures or other words.
- Word searches: These worksheets help students to identify sight words in a puzzle format.
- Fill-in-the-blank worksheets: These worksheets provide students with a sentence with a missing sight word, and they must fill in the blank with the correct word.
- Writing worksheets: These worksheets give students the opportunity to practice writing sight words.

Interactivity
Interactivity is an essential component of kindergarten sight word worksheets. When students are actively engaged in the learning process, they are more likely to remember and retain information. Hands-on activities are especially beneficial for young learners, as they provide a concrete and engaging way to learn new concepts.
There are many different ways to make sight word worksheets more interactive and hands-on. Some examples include:
- Using manipulatives, such as letter tiles or magnetic letters, to build sight words.
- Creating sight word games, such as sight word bingo or sight word memory.
- Having students write sight words in sand, shaving cream, or other sensory materials.
- Using technology to create interactive sight word activities, such as online games or apps.
By incorporating interactive and hands-on activities into sight word worksheets, you can make learning sight words more fun and engaging for your students.

Assessment
Assessment is an essential component of effective sight word instruction. It allows teachers to track students’ progress and identify areas where they need additional support. Sight word worksheets can be used as a valuable assessment tool, as they provide a structured and systematic way to assess students’ sight word recognition and reading skills.
There are many different ways to use sight word worksheets for assessment. One way is to use them as a pre-test and post-test. By giving students the same worksheet at the beginning and end of a unit or lesson, teachers can measure students’ progress over time. Another way to use sight word worksheets for assessment is to use them as exit tickets. Exit tickets are short, informal assessments that can be used to assess students’ understanding of a concept at the end of a lesson. Sight word worksheets can also be used as formative assessments. Formative assessments are used to provide feedback to students and teachers throughout the learning process. By using sight word worksheets as formative assessments, teachers can identify students who are struggling and provide them with additional support.

Kindergarten sight word worksheets are educational tools designed to help young learners recognize and comprehend common words without sounding them out phonetically. These worksheets typically feature high-frequency words that appear frequently in written text, such as “the,” “and,” “is,” and “of.” By repeatedly encountering these words in various contexts and activities, kindergarteners develop the ability to instantly recognize them, which significantly improves their reading fluency and comprehension.
The use of kindergarten sight word worksheets offers numerous benefits for young learners. Firstly, it enhances their vocabulary by introducing them to a wide range of frequently used words. Secondly, it strengthens their reading fluency by allowing them to recognize words quickly and effortlessly, which in turn improves their overall reading comprehension. Additionally, these worksheets foster a love for reading by making the learning process interactive and engaging.
Kindergarten sight word worksheets have been an integral part of early childhood education for decades. They have evolved over time to incorporate more interactive and developmentally appropriate activities, such as matching games, puzzles, and creative writing exercises. With the advent of technology, digital sight word worksheets have also emerged, offering interactive and engaging experiences on tablets and computers.
